Simple.Tools

Date Difference Calculator

Calculate the exact difference between two dates in days, months, and years.
Rating 4.5/5 | 0 comments | Free
Download

About Tool

Calculating the exact span between two points in time is surprisingly complex due to varying month lengths and leap years. This Date Difference Calculator removes the guesswork by providing a precise breakdown of the duration between any two dates. Whether you are tracking the progress of a long-term goal, calculating someone's age in days, or determining the length of a historical period, this tool gives you a clear, calendar-aware summary of the result.

Inclusive and Exclusive Counting

A common point of confusion in date math is whether to include the last day. For example, from Monday to Tuesday is 1 day if you are counting the "gap," but 2 days if you are counting the "duration" of an event. This tool includes a toggle for Include end date in calculation (+1 day), allowing you to switch between these two modes depending on your specific needs. If you are calculating the length of a project that only occurs on workdays, the Working Days Calculator is the perfect next step to refine your results.

How to Calculate the Duration

  1. Select the "Start Date" from the calendar picker.
  2. Select the "End Date." The tool can handle both forward and backward calculations.
  3. Check the "Include end date" box if your project or event includes the final day.
  4. Click "Calculate Difference" to see the result.
  5. Use "Copy Result" to save the summary, which includes the total days, months, and years.

Use Cases for Date Math

This calculator is used daily for a variety of personal and professional tasks. HR professionals use it to determine seniority or benefit eligibility. Project managers use it to verify the total calendar time allotted for a milestone. For those working with specific formatting for reports, using the Date Format Converter after finding your dates can help present the information professionally. It is also a fun way to find out exactly how many days old you are or how many days are left until a major life event.

Privacy and Accuracy

Simple.Tools performs all date calculations within your browser's local memory. Your dates are never uploaded or stored on our servers. The algorithm is fully calendar-aware, correctly accounting for the 29th of February in leap years and the differing number of days in each month (30 vs 31). If you need to know the specific time elapsed (hours and minutes) in addition to days, you might prefer our Time Duration Calculator.

Frequently Asked Questions

What does "inclusive" mean in this context?

An inclusive calculation means you are counting both the start and the end day as full units. For a three-day weekend (Friday, Saturday, Sunday), the inclusive count is 3 days, while the standard difference is 2 days.

Does this tool handle leap years?

Yes. The tool uses standard UTC date logic that accounts for leap years and the varying lengths of months to provide a 100% accurate count.

Can I calculate the difference in just hours?

This tool focuses on dates (days, months, years). For sub-day calculations involving hours and minutes, please use our dedicated Time Duration Calculator.

What happens if the start date is after the end date?

The tool will calculate the difference and present it as a duration. It typically treats the interval as an absolute value or indicates the chronological order in the summary.

Reviews

Compact review form with star rating.
Showing the latest 50 approved comments for this tool and language.

Similar Tools

  • Business Days Calculator

    Count working days between dates while excluding weekends and optional holidays.

  • Date Calculator

    Add or subtract days, weeks, months, or years from any date instantly.

  • Date Format Converter

    Convert dates between common display formats for spreadsheets, APIs, and forms.

  • Days Calculator

    Count the number of days between two dates or after adding a duration to a date.

  • Time Calculator

    Add and subtract hours, minutes, and seconds for work, travel, and schedule calculations.

  • Time Duration Calculator

    Calculate total duration across multiple start and end times in one compact tool.

  • Time Zone Converter

    Convert times across world time zones for meetings and remote work planning.

  • Timestamp to Date

    Convert timestamps into readable dates and times with UTC and local display options.